Offered in 0 more formatsThis draft documents the proceedings of a workshop that had the objective of laying the groundwork for the development of an adaptive management plan for hillslope, riparian, & in-stream restoration that incorporates effectiveness evaluations, feedback to management, and provision for changes in the British Columbia Watershed Restoration Program when & where necessary. The workshop opened with plenary sessions to establish the workshop purpose, set the stage for discussions, and reach common understanding of a framework for more detailed discussions. This was followed with discussions by three sub-groups of participants that considered how adaptive management could be used to increase knowledge regarding the success of the following restoration activities: sediment management activities & sediment supply/transport; hydrology/water management activities and the hydrologic regime; and vegetation management activities, vegetation growth, and large woody debris supply & transport. At the end of the workshop, the subgroups returned to plenary for final integration and review of lessons learned.
